Ultrasonic Extraction Technology

Sep 01, 2025

Leave a message

Ultrasonic extraction equipment is a modern extraction apparatus that utilizes the cavitation, mechanical, and thermal effects of ultrasonic waves to efficiently disrupt material cells and release their constituents through high-frequency vibration. Its core components are the ultrasonic generator and transducer: the generator converts electrical energy into high-frequency electrical signals, while the transducer transforms these into mechanical vibrations transmitted through a probe (horn) into the extraction solvent. Ultrasonic waves generate alternating high-pressure and low-pressure cycles within liquids, forming countless micrometer-sized cavitation bubbles that collapse instantaneously. This releases immense energy that impacts material cell walls, accelerating the dissolution of active components (such as alkaloids, polysaccharides, flavonoids) within cells. Simultaneously, mechanical agitation and localized heating enhance diffusion rates.

This equipment is primarily suited for extracting natural products in industries like traditional Chinese medicine, food, and cosmetics. Its advantages include high extraction efficiency (reducing processing time by over 50% compared to traditional methods), controllable temperature (preventing degradation of heat-sensitive components), minimal solvent usage, simple operation, and strong compatibility, enabling extraction at ambient or low temperatures. By replacing harsh chemical solvent reactions with physical fragmentation, ultrasonic extraction technology aligns with green environmental principles and has become a vital tool in high-efficiency extraction.
